Keys to the car have been lost

Losing your car keys can be a nightmare scenario for any driver, and it happens at the most inconvenient times. It can be stressful, especially if you are caught in a hurry or late for an important appointment. There are solutions, such as hiring an automotive locksmith. These experts can help you create a new key to your vehicle, allowing you to get back on the road quickly and safely.

The first thing you need to do if you lose your car keys is to avoid to be in a panic. It's difficult, but keeping your calm makes the situation easier. This allows you to retrace the steps and hopefully locate your keys. If you're not able to locate them, contact an emergency locksmith to help.

There are a variety of ways to replace keys for cars that have been lost, and some options are more affordable than others. You can buy the replacement car key from a dealership but it can be costly. You can also employ an automotive locksmith to replace your keys which is typically less expensive and quicker.

Many cars now use key fobs instead of keys. They are like remote controls and they can be programmed by locksmiths to fit your specific vehicle model. Locksmiths will need to make use of a specific software and tool to accomplish this. They might need to take out the old key from your system so that no one else will be able to use it.

Broken car keys

If you're having issues with your car keys, it may be time to call an automotive locksmith. They'll be able to help you in a quick manner and offer the help you require to get on your way. Here are some of the most common reasons your car keys may not work.

Your car keys might not work due to a malfunctioning keyfob. This happens when it is unable to program itself. This is because all key fobs have to be "paired" with the vehicle that they're meant to operate in. A locksmith can re-program your key fob in order that it is paired with your vehicle again.

A broken key blade can be the reason for your car keys not working. If this is the situation, you'll need to get a new one made. This is typically done by locksmiths, and usually involves making the key from scratch. To program the new car key, the locksmith will require the make, model, and year of your vehicle, and VIN.

It's possible to to remove a broken car key yourself, but you should be cautious when doing this. It is essential not to damage the cylinder that controls ignition. Instead you should use a flathead screwdriver that is small enough to fit inside the lock. Then, you should gradually pull it up to loosen the position of the broken piece. It is also recommended to avoid using magnets as they can damage electronic components in the key.

If the key is inside the lock, you'll need employ a tool specifically designed specifically for this purpose. These tools are narrow, flat and have hooks that slide over the broken key to lever it from the lock. They can be purchased at the majority of hardware stores. You should also have a lubricant on hand, such as silicone spray or graphite powder to assist in the removal process. Patience will be the key to success, as you might have to repeat the process several times until the break is freed.
